Sika Launches All-In-One Repair Mortar

Construction News Image

Sika has introduced MonoTop®-412 N, an all-in-one repair mortar ideal for a range of concrete-based repairs.

The new solution increases the bearing capacity of vital infrastructure such as buildings, bridges and tunnels. Sulphate-resistant and fibre-reinforced, this high-performance system offers a one hit solution when embedding galvanic anodes. Due to its low resistivity figure Sika MonoTop®-412 N is fully compatible with Sika Galvashield XP Anodes. With an extremely favourable high-yield (up to 13.7 litres per 25kg bag). Its cost-effectivity is reinforced by eliminating the need to adjust consistency in order to build layers. In addition, the low-shrinkage system negates the need for a bonding primer, even when manually applied.

Jamie Squires, Product Manager at Sika, said: "We are delighted to introduce this superb repair innovation to the construction sector. Our daily lives depend on the structural integrity of concrete buildings such as tunnels, bridges and the like being upheld. Sika MonoTop®-412 N simplifies the repair of such infrastructure, allowing a greater layer thickness and negating the need for a separate embedding mortar when the application of an anodic system is required, thus ensuring renovation time and cost is kept to a minimum."

Sika MonoTop®-412 N meets the requirement of class-R4 of EN 1504-3. Hand or machine applied, 50mm of product can be installed in one layer. The system does not require a bonding primer, even when manually applied.

Additional benefits such as low permeability and an A1 fire rating, make Sika MonoTop®-412 N the ideal embedding mortar for contaminated or carbonated concrete replacement.
